I'm a ghost hunter, and I always set up the cameras in each location I investigate. I also make YouTube videos.

 

One thing that would make it much better and easier to edit and make videos is motion detection. Like, any motion or change in the screen would put the marker on the clip. It would allow me to check out every detected motion, instead of sitting down and staring at the screen for hours.

 

Yes, I've used the scene edit detection feature, but it's not the same.

You could take a still of the empty room and add it to V2, set the blend mode to difference. You would then have a black screen until there is movement on the main track. It might be easier to spool through and find motion. Looking at the video waveform will show a flat line until something moves.
